#include "util/s3_uri.h"
#include <gtest/gtest.h>
#include <string>
#include "util/logging.h"
namespace doris {
class S3URITest : public testing::Test {
public:
S3URITest() {}
~S3URITest() {}
}; // end class StringParserTest
TEST_F(S3URITest, LocationParsing) {
std::string p1 = "s3://bucket/path/to/file";
S3URI uri1(p1);
ASSERT_TRUE(uri1.parse());
ASSERT_EQ("bucket", uri1.get_bucket());
ASSERT_EQ("path/to/file", uri1.get_key());
}
TEST_F(S3URITest, PathLocationParsing) {
std::string p1 = "s3://bucket/path/";
S3URI uri1(p1);
ASSERT_TRUE(uri1.parse());
ASSERT_EQ("bucket", uri1.get_bucket());
ASSERT_EQ("path/", uri1.get_key());
}
TEST_F(S3URITest, EncodedString) {
std::string p1 = "s3://bucket/path%20to%20file";
S3URI uri1(p1);
ASSERT_TRUE(uri1.parse());
ASSERT_EQ("bucket", uri1.get_bucket());
ASSERT_EQ("path%20to%20file", uri1.get_key());
}
TEST_F(S3URITest, MissingKey) {
std::string p1 = "https://bucket/";
S3URI uri1(p1);
ASSERT_FALSE(uri1.parse());
std::string p2 = "s3://bucket/";
S3URI uri2(p2);
ASSERT_FALSE(uri2.parse());
}
TEST_F(S3URITest, RelativePathing) {
std::string p1 = "/path/to/file";
S3URI uri1(p1);
ASSERT_FALSE(uri1.parse());
}
TEST_F(S3URITest, InvalidScheme) {
std::string p1 = "ftp://bucket/";
S3URI uri1(p1);
ASSERT_FALSE(uri1.parse());
}
TEST_F(S3URITest, QueryAndFragment) {
std::string p1 = "s3://bucket/path/to/file?query=foo#bar";
S3URI uri1(p1);
ASSERT_TRUE(uri1.parse());
ASSERT_EQ("bucket", uri1.get_bucket());
ASSERT_EQ("path/to/file", uri1.get_key());
}
} // end namespace doris
int main(int argc, char** argv) {
::testing::InitGoogleTest(&argc, argv);
return RUN_ALL_TESTS();
}
